Cognitive Development
A process involving the growth and enhancement of mental abilities, such as thinking, reasoning, problem-solving, and understanding, throughout a person's life.
Formal Operations
The final stage of cognitive development in Piaget's theory, typically beginning around age 12, characterized by the ability to think abstractly, logically, and systematically.
Jean Piaget
A Swiss psychologist known for his pioneering work in child development, specifically his theory of cognitive development that explains how children construct a mental model of the world.
Psychosocial Development
A theory proposed by Erik Erickson that suggests an individual's development is influenced by social experiences across eight stages of life from infancy to late adulthood.
